Now learning is providing Lab instance which they are setting specifically for leanring purpose- which cant be replicated 100% on PDI. Even if you will replicate somehow tasks can't be validated on PDI as they are validated on lab instances. In short Lab instances are different and PDI is different, don't mix or confuse between these two.
